Moreover, the CS Professional exam for 2025, December session, comprises 9 papers, with one of them being elective. What's interesting is that the Multidisciplinary Case Studies and one of the 8 elective papers will be open-book exams, meaning candidates can refer to their study materials during the test. This structure simplifies the CS Professional Exam, which consists of three modules, each with three subjects. Module 1 focuses on governance, tax laws, and legal skills. Module 2 covers auditing, corporate restructuring, and dispute resolution. Module 3 includes topics related to finance, case studies, and an elective subject. Check the table below for a better understanding of the CS Professional Exam Pattern 2025:
ICSI CS Professional Exam Pattern 2025 | |||
Modules | Paper Name | No. of Marks | Duration |
Module 1 | Governance, Risk Management, Compliances and Ethics | 100 | 3 hr |
Advanced Tax laws | 100 | 3 hr | |
Drafting, Pleadings and Appearances | 100 | 3 hr | |
Module 2 | Secretarial Audit, Compliance Management and Due Diligence | 100 | 3 hr |
Corporate Reconstructing, Insolvency, Liquidation and winding up | 100 | 3 hr | |
Resolution of Corporate Disputes, Non- Compliances, and Remedies | 100 | 3 hr | |
Module 3 | Corporate Funding and Listing in Stock Exchanges | 100 | 3 hr |
Multidisciplinary Case Studies | 100 | 3 hr | |
Elective Subject (1 out of 8) of module 3 | Banking- Law, and Practice | 100 | 3 hr |
Insurance- Law and Practice | |||
Intellectual Property Rights- Laws and Practice | |||
Forensic Audit | |||
Direct Tax Laws and Practice | |||
Labour Laws and Practice | |||
Valuations and Business Modelling | |||
Insolvency- Law and Practice |
In the CS Professional Exam Pattern 2025, ICSI has established specific minimum scores that candidates need to reach in order to pass the exams. These scores are set differently for each section of the exam, and there's also an overall passing requirement. In simple terms, candidates must achieve these minimum passing marks to qualify for the CS Professional 2025 exams.
ICSI CS Professional Exam Pattern 2025 Passing Criteria | |
Particulars | Cut-off Percentage |
Sectional Cut-off/ Paper | 40% |
Overall CS Professional Cut-off | 50% |
Check the below table here for the Distribution of marks as per the new syllabus:
CS Professional Exam Pattern 2025 Distribution of Marks as Per New Syllabus (2024) | |
CS Professional New Syllabus | Marks Distribution |
Governance, Risk Management, Compliances and Ethics | Part I: Governance (50 Marks) Part II: Risk Management (20 Marks) Part III: Compliance (20 Marks) Part IV: Ethics & Sustainability (10 Marks) |
Secretarial Audit, Compliance Management and Due Diligence | Part I: Compliance Management (40 Marks) Part II: Secretarial Audit &Due Diligence (60 Marks) |
Corporate Funding and Listings in Stock Exchanges | Part-A: Corporate Funding (60 Marks) Part B: Listing (40 Marks) |
